Matt White: Relief Pitcher. Non-Roster Invitee. Billionaire.

Matt White, a 27-year-old lefty reliever who's played a grand total of two non-consecutive seasons in Major League baseball and possesses a career ERA of 16.76, may shortly become one of the richest men in pro sports--richer than Tiger Woods, richer than Michael Jordan, richer, even, than Martha Stewart.

Three years ago, the AP reports, White bought a fifty-acre parcel of land for $50,000 from an elderly aunt in need of fast cash. A surveyor subsequently informed him that the parcel sits on 24 million tons of high-quality, quarryable stone. At $100 per ton, that works out to $2 billion, though the costs involved in mining it would likely reduce its market value to (according to one expert quoted in the piece) "several million dollars, or more."

White has put the property on the block and turned his attention to winning a roster spot with the Los Angeles Dodgers. His chances are not great.
